The Economic Mathematics: Why $100,000 Changes Everything

Cost Structure Explosion

Traditional H1-B Economics:

  • Previous total cost: ~$5,000-$10,000 (including legal fees)
  • Typical 3-year visa duration
  • Annual cost per employee: ~$2,000-$3,500

New H1-B Economics:

  • New total cost: ~$105,000-$110,000
  • Same 3-year duration
  • Annual cost per employee: ~$35,000-$37,000

Break-Even Analysis: The fee makes H1-B workers economically viable only for:

  • Senior engineers earning $200,000+ annually
  • Specialized roles with 70%+ wage premiums over domestic alternatives
  • Mission-critical positions where replacement costs exceed visa fees

Historical Parallels and Lessons

1924 Immigration Act: Restricted European immigration, leading to:

  • Labor shortages in key industries
  • Wage inflation for domestic workers
  • Automation acceleration in manufacturing
  • Regional economic redistribution

1965 Immigration Act: Opened skilled worker immigration, resulting in:

  • Technology sector boom from 1970s onward
  • Innovation acceleration in Silicon Valley
  • Economic multiplier effects across supporting industries
  • Global competitive advantages for US tech

Current Reversal: The H1-B fee represents a potential return to restrictionist policies with unknown consequences.
